Moldova, with US support, will purchase emergency power generators for hospitals and companies providing important social services.

This was announced by the Ministry of Infrastructure and Regional Development, noting that the Moldovan government, in cooperation with the USAID Moldova Energy Security Activity (MESA) project, announced a tender for the purchase of new emergency power generators. They will be designed for city and district hospitals, power transmission operators, heating and water supply companies to provide them with electricity in the short term in emergencies. The deadline for submitting proposals is 15 December. The goal of the 4-year Moldova Energy Security Activity (MESA), funded by the United States Agency for International Development (USAID), is to strengthen Moldova's energy security by: promoting the physical and market integration of the Moldovan energy sector with Europe; strengthening the integration of renewable energy sources; increasing investment in energy efficiency and domestic electricity generation, especially through increased deployment of renewable energy technologies. In this context, MESA is working with the Government of Moldova to procure new emergency generators or replace non-functioning units to provide short-term emergency power to critical loads within a specific building or facility. This will ensure the minimum requirements for the operation of critical and social infrastructure facilities in accordance with the priorities of the Moldovan government. Under the Energy Security Fund, MESA plans to work with 22 municipal and regional hospitals, an electricity transmission operator, thermal power companies and water companies to deploy up to 4 MW of generating capacity. // 01.12.2022 — InfoMarket
